Ebook asp mvc upload multiple files at once

Assuming that you are running visual studio 2015 ctp 6 you can also get that from azure vm or later and you have created an asp. Every so often a question pops up on the forum asking why their multiple file download code only sends the first file. In this article i explain a new functionality of asp. In this article ill show how to overcome this issue by synchronously upload a file using jquery and async webapi controller. Is there a way to upload multiple files by clicking one button. Net mvc that serve to resolve one or another upload tasks, for example you may need to upload single or multiple. Aug 07, 2014 i have used your code in our mvc 4 project to do exactly what we need at my company. I wanted to confirm something about how to upload a file or set of files with asp.

Net upload multiple files using fileupload control youtube. To achieve this, set the multiplefilesselection property to true. This is a really interesting question for a number of reasons and a great opportunity to explore some fundamentals. Net, you could use the html fileupload control to upload files. Theres no server controls in the way that were used to them. What i tried to do in this article is to provide a way to upload multiple files using one instance of the specified control. Upload multiple files to azure storage and manage them from. Im sure that you have seen a lot of examples about how to upload multiple files using multiple instances of the htmlinputfile asp.

Net mvc and the first search result for the phrase uploading a file with mvc is scott hanselmans blog post on the topic. Second, itd be important to write unit tests for something like file upload, and since asp. Once files have been uploaded, they get a url and as we can see above, the files are hyperlinked to this url. Multiple uploads sample multiple uploads with file upload. Kendo ui ui for jquery ui for angular ui for react ui for vue ui for asp.

Files, for each iteration, the value of file will be the string value attachment, which is the. The below code snippet will show the personal details html that has been created for the user to insert data into the list. Upload and delete files using jquery multifile library. In this article, we will first explore how to upload a file using the fileupload control and then extend the functionality to upload multiple files.

The examples are for an umbraco website, but the principles are the same. This example shows the directory upload functionality of asp. The fileupload control only supported a single file at the time. But when uploading multiple files, we are receiving multiple posts one for each file. How to let users upload one file or multiple files. Multiple uploads sample multiple uploads with file. Below is the full code to read fileupload control file content in asp. One alternative is to provide a number of inputs for users of ie9 or lower. Upload multiple attachments to list items using jsom and rest api in sharepoint online.

Uploading files in core is largely the same as standard full framework mvc, with the large exception being how you can now stream large files. Net core supports uploading one or more files using buffered model binding for smaller files and unbuffered streaming for larger files. Ajax uploader is an easy to use, hiperformance asp. If its just the multiple thing not working, try giving the different inputs different names, or call them ad1file0 and ad1file1. I used file upload in ajaxtoolbox in webform before and like how it works. Upload multiple files using fileupload control in asp.

Net mvc file upload control which allows you to upload multiple files to web server without refreshing the page. Net mvc and the first search result for the phrase uploading a file with mvc is scott hanselmans blog post on the topic his blog post is very thorough and helps provide a great understanding of whats happening under the hood. Net mvc file upload r2 2018 release is here now with modern ui for chatbots and more. How to upload multiple files using html5 multiple file input with additional model data. How to save files to a specific path on the server not in database. Use caution when providing users with the ability to upload files to a server. For demonstration purposes, uploaded files must be smaller than 1 mb. Net mvc 4 web application, we are going to choose empty template to avoid unecessary files and settings for this sample web. Before proceeding with this example, it is recommended to learn how to upload a single file on the server in the previous examples. This demo also shows how a custom popup progress panel can be implemented to display upload progress information for both the currently processed file and the entire uploaded data. On html 5enabled browsers those which support multiple attributes on the input element, you can select multiple files at once from the open file dialog or drag and drop the files from windows explorer directly on the igupload component. We are saving the files in a database table and need to prepopulate the page with files that are in the database if user decides to close out of application and come back to it. Lets extend the above sample to upload multiple files at a time.

Instead of uploading files one by one, it is better to use multiple files upload in your application so that it can save user time and effort. To upload multiple file, we will follow the same approach as we followed for single. Net mvc tries to be unit test friendly, its an interesting problem to do tests. In this article, we will first explore how to upload a file using the fileupload control and then extend the. Uploading multiple files in 2 free download as pdf file. Net mvc how to upload multiple files on server in asp. Mar 27, 2018 this post will help you if you need to upload multiple files at once in an mvc form. Oct 19, 2015 this brief article shows how to upload multiple files in an asp.

In this video tutorial, i will show you, how to upload multiple files in asp. This is thoroughly explained in the following tutorial. The file object, which provides a way to manage files. This sample shows you how to set our jquery upload control to operate with multiple files. A number of folks have asked me how to implement the asp. This brief article shows how to upload multiple files in an asp. What then is the point to enumerating through the files if. The uploadbox widget provides support to upload multiple files spontaneously. His blog post is very thorough and helps provide a great understanding of whats happening under the hood. However there were a couple of efforts required by the developer to do so.

Common solutions to uploading multiple files were to use a serverside control such as those from telerik or devexpress or to use a clientside solution using a jquery plugin for example. Today well see how we can do the same but store it in a file system instead and use a web api controller instead, so that the upload service can be hosted anywhere we want. This is how we can upload multiple files using the file upload control in. Net programming features introduced in the article. Net mvc application by using only html solutions no flash. This tutorial explains the following things in asp. Html5 has provided an additional feature to select and upload multiple files and the same will be used along with asp. Net mvc 4 5 uploading and downloading a file using wcf restful service with asp. Typically, the code consists of a loop that iterates a collection of files and attempts to use response. On html 5enabled browsers those which support multiple attributes on the input element, you can select multiple files at once. In the above code snippet, we have more than one html file upload element and also have kept multiple attribute that supports only in html 5 this ensures that a single html file element enable user to select multiple file by holding ctrl key and remaining codes are same as last point of uploading a single file on the server. Now, we will see how to read content from a file in fileupload control directly without saving anywhere in the server.

The maxsimultaneousfilesuploads and maxuploadedfiles properties can be used to restrict the number of uploaded files when uploading more than one file. The path object, which provides methods that let you manipulate path and file names. In this blog post you will learn how to take advantage of html5 in mvc to turn single file upload into multiple file upload functionality. Net mvc, one of the things i struggled with the most was how to do file uploads while posting additional model data.

It describes the multiple attribute available as part of html5 and shows how to fallback to an alternative solution in the cases where the browser lacks the required support. The multiplefilesselection property enables you to select multiple files while browsing. Single file upload to multiple file upload in mvc or uploading a file or files with asp. In this article, i will show you a sample to how to upload and save files in asp. Lets start implementing this scenario, step by step with the help of a simple asp. This is a 500 pages concise technical ebook available in pdf, epub ipad, and mobi. We will go over both methods of uploading a file in core. Transmitfile or a fileresult in mvc to dispatch each file to the client. When the 2nd button is clicked, the plainuploadfiles method is called. Google how to upload files using mvc and jquery, as this is possible if the client has html5, if they dont have html5 youll need to use a plugin designed for ajax uploads for older browsers. Add a html form and input typeform element in your mvc view. Net mvc, see tutorial techbrijfile uploadcrudaspnetmvc. Mar 14, 2014 in this blog post you will learn how to take advantage of html5 in mvc to turn single file upload into multiple file upload functionality. With radasyncupload you can quickly allow users to upload multiple files at a time.

Uploading files from a client computer to the remote server is quite a common task for many websites and applications. I had written a post on dotnetcurry on how to upload multiplefiles to an azure blob through an asp. We can upload multiple methods in two ways that i have shown here. The user should be able to see a list of files they selected with an option to remove individual files and then hit the uplolad button for the upload process to start. When we click the url, we should be able to see or download the file. First we are going to start by creating new mvc4 web application. Here mudassar ahmed khan has explained with an example, how to upload files using jquery ajax in asp. Today almost every browser extended the support to html5 and in case any browser does not, it will still work as it was working before and upload single file at a time. It allows endusers to choose several files to upload within a single file open dialog. Using the jquery uploadify plugin, one can easily upload multiple files using jquery and ajax in asp. It allows you select and upload multiple files and cancel running file uploads, add new files during uploading.

Jul 16, 2010 i wanted to confirm something about how to upload a file or set of files with asp. How to upload multiple files at once in an mvc form. Model binding iformfile small files when uploading a file via this method, the important thing to. Net core ui for blazor ui for silverlight ui for php ui for jsp.

This post will help you if you need to upload multiple files at once in an mvc form. Net core web api app how to export data in excel, pdf, csv, word, json. Upload and delete files using jquery multifile library in. In this article we will focus on how to upload image files using asp. In this article i am going to demonstrate about multiple file upload and delete in mvc application by using jquery.

Net mvc framework and display the images using our custom image htmlhelper. Aug 27, 2015 this tutorial explains the following things in asp. I have used your code in our mvc 4 project to do exactly what we need at my company. There are many ways to upload multiple files in asp. However if we click on the file, we are likely to see this. This demo illustrates upload controls multifile selection capability. So in the current scenario, the ids of the widgets are irrelevant and the only.

Call the uploadfileusingaspnetfileuploadsingle m ethod shown above multiple times and pass. Once upload completes, the application navigates back to the file list. How to upload and download files asynchronously using asp. In html one tag highlighted to facilitate multifile upload control, i am leveraging jquery. Uploading files to a server is a common operation of many websites. Multiple upload controls in mvc view in ui for asp. The uploadbox control provides support to upload multiple files spontaneously. Aug 16, 2016 there are many ways to upload multiple files in asp. Providing users the ability to upload files to a server also requires the ability to remove files although users only have this ability indirectly by deleting the data that has a reference to the file. Its widely used in social nets, forums, online auctions, etc. Jun 22, 2015 in this article i am going to demonstrate about multiple file upload and delete in asp. Sep, 20 this is how we can upload multiple files using the file upload control in asp. Common solutions to uploading multiple files were to use a serverside control such as those from telerik or devexpress or to use a clientside solution using a jquery.

486 129 1142 568 1679 1571 719 641 371 712 1377 906 297 820 1094 1189 1409 1241 66 1671 1357 1052 362 335 877 877 905 1000 559 322 1494 463 1457